Abstract

This study aims to examine the effectiveness of implementing online CBT-I on older adults with sleep disorders. The method used is a Systematic Review guiding a search of 4 databases, ScienceDirect, Scopus, PubMed, and UI Lib, in October 2023 with article publication years starting from 2019-2023 to identify all relevant journal articles. The search technique follows the PRISMA flow. The research results showed that online CBT-I was proven to be effective in treating insomnia sleep disorders in the elderly. CBT-I can even treat secondary disorders due to insomnia, such as depression and anxiety. In conclusion, Online CBT-I can be implemented in health services provided that there is adequate computer and internet accessibility. Keywords: Online CBT, Insomnia, Sleep Disorders, Elderly

Abstract

This study aims to analyze the benefits of music therapy intervention on pain experienced by children treated in the Pediatric Intensive Care Unit (PICU). The method used is through searching for articles adapted to the formulation of research questions using the PICO formula in the EMBASE, Clinicalkey for Nursing, Proquest, ScienceDirect, Springer Link, Pubmed, and Scopus databases. The research results showed that music therapy for children treated in the PICU varied, including live music therapy, recorded music therapy, music therapy and hand massage, and music and video therapy. In conclusion, intervention through music therapy has proven to be effective in reducing pain, increasing comfort, and stabilizing children's hemodynamics. Abstract

This research aims to determine the stress, burnout, and coping of nurses during the COVID-19 pandemic in hospitals. The research method used is a literature review by selecting a theme and determining keywords (Keywords) and Boolean operators (AND, OR NOT, or AND NOT) before searching for scientific articles online. The literature search in this literature review used 4 databases, namely, Cochrane Library, Pubmed, Scopus, and ProQuest. The research results show that psychological symptoms that appeared in health workers due to the COVID-19 pandemic, such as depression, anxiety, stress, PTSD, fatigue, insomnia, and somatic symptoms, increased during the beginning of this pandemic. In conclusion, nurses experience a lot of work stress, medical professional burnout (emotional exhaustion, depersonalization, and a low sense of personal accomplishment), and mental health. Stress prevention should be adapted to the characteristics of the workplace, taking into account workplace optimization, social support, and compensation for workers' efforts. Abstract

This study aims to determine the correlation of the duration of smartphone use with sleep quality and learning achievement of Riau Banking Vocational School students. The method used is a correlation design with a cross sectional approach. The results showed that there was a relationship between the duration of smartphone use with sleep quality with a p-value of 0.002. As for the duration of smartphone use with learning achievement, there is no relationship with a p-value of 0.156. It is concluded that the duration of smartphone use is one of the factors that affect sleep quality in adolescents and for learning achievement there are other factors that affect student achievement. Abstract

This study aims to show the effectiveness of essential oil aromatherapy for pain compared with standard intervention measures in patients after gastrointestinal surgery. The research method used is a systematic review through databases and electronic websites, namely Pubmed, Science Direct, ProQuest, Embase and Sage Journals. The results of the study showed that from 5 research articles, data was obtained that giving Aromatherapy essential oils was proven to reduce pain after gastrointestinal surgical procedures, including lavender oil, geranium oil, mixing lavender, ylang-ylang, marjoram and neroli oils as well as sweet orange and rose types. Silk cloth. Conclusion: The addition of aromatherapy to standard therapy significantly reduces the severity of postoperative pain compared to standard therapy with or without placebo. Abstract

This study aims to describe the effect of muscle stretching exercises during hemodialysis on muscle cramps. The research method uses an integrative review approach by searching articles using 6 databases, namely ProQuest, ClinicalKey Nursing, Sage Journals, ScienceDirect, Scopus, and ResearchGate. Article searches were carried out from March 5 2024 to March 25 2024. Article searches used the keywords stretching intradialysis, cramps intradialysis, exercises intradialysis, and muscle cramps. Preferred reporting items for systematic reviews and Meta-analysis (PRISMA) were used in the review. Results: From the results of the article search, it was found that muscle stretching exercises during hemodialysis carried out at the end of the HD session were proven to be able to prevent and reduce the intensity of muscle cramps in hemodialysis patients. Conclusion: Muscle stretching exercises performed during hemodialysis have been proven to prevent and reduce the intensity of muscle cramps during hemodialysis Keyword: Muscle cramps, Stretching intradialysis, Muscle stretching
